How this works
Almond flour has a density of about 0.406 g/mL (king arthur baking: 1 cup = 96g). That means 1 mL of almond flour weighs 0.406 grams.
Grams = cups × 96.0547
Note: Blanched, finely ground.
Why a cup of almond flour doesn't always weigh the same
Volume measurements are forgiving in some ways and brutal in others. A cup of almond flour can vary by 10-20% in weight depending on how it's measured: spooned vs scooped, packed vs loose, sifted vs unsifted. The density figure used here matches the most common published recipe conventions, but if you're after baking precision, weighing on a kitchen scale is more accurate than measuring by volume.
